60 * struct spi_flash_params - SPI/QSPI flash device params structure
62 * @name: Device name ([MANUFLETTER][DEVTYPE][DENSITY][EXTRAINFO])
63 * @jedec: Device jedec ID (0x[1byte_manuf_id][2byte_dev_id])
64 * @ext_jedec: Device ext_jedec ID
65 * @sector_size: Sector size of this device
66 * @nr_sectors: No.of sectors on this device
67 * @e_rd_cmd: Enum list for read commands
68 * @flags: Important param, for flash specific behaviour

83 * struct spi_flash - SPI flash structure
86 * @name: Name of SPI flash
87 * @dual_flash: Indicates dual flash memories - dual stacked, parallel
88 * @shift: Flash shift useful in dual parallel
89 * @size: Total flash size
90 * @page_size: Write (page) size
91 * @sector_size: Sector size
92 * @erase_size: Erase size
93 * @bank_read_cmd: Bank read cmd
94 * @bank_write_cmd: Bank write cmd
95 * @bank_curr: Current flash bank
96 * @poll_cmd: Poll cmd - for flash erase/program
97 * @erase_cmd: Erase cmd 4K, 32K, 64K
98 * @read_cmd: Read cmd - Array Fast, Extn read and quad read.
99 * @write_cmd: Write cmd - page and quad program.
100 * @dummy_byte: Dummy cycles for read operation.
101 * @memory_map: Address of read-only SPI flash access
102 * @read: Flash read ops: Read len bytes at offset into buf
103 * Supported cmds: Fast Array Read
104 * @write: Flash write ops: Write len bytes from buf into offset
105 * Supported cmds: Page Program
106 * @erase: Flash erase ops: Erase len bytes from offset
107 * Supported cmds: Sector erase 4K, 32K, 64K
108 * return 0 - Success, 1 - Failure
